Abstract

PROBLEM TO BE SOLVED: To allow a relay to be easily attached to an electric component unit.SOLUTION: An air conditioner comprises an outdoor unit including an electric component unit 5 comprising electric components for driving a compressor, and a bracket 10 comprising a reactor fixing base 11 attached to the electric component unit 5. The bracket 10 is provided with a relay fixing base 13 that fixes a relay 2 adjacently to the reactor fixing base 11. The relay fixing base 13 is provided with temporary fixing means 131 (preferably a locking claw 131a consisting of a raised piece) that retains the relay 2 at a fixing position.SELECTED DRAWING: Figure 2

本発明は空気調和機、特にはその室外機に関し、さらに詳しく言えば、電気部品の電装品ユニットへの取り付け構造に関するものである。   The present invention relates to an air conditioner, and more particularly to an outdoor unit thereof, and more particularly to a structure for mounting an electrical component to an electrical component unit.

室外機の電装品ユニットには、圧縮機を駆動するための種々の電気部品が設けられているが、その一つとしてリアクタがある。リアクタは、インバータにより圧縮機を駆動する際に発生するノイズを低減するために用いられるが、積層鉄心に銅線コイルを巻回した構造であることから比較的大型で重量もある。   The electrical component unit of the outdoor unit is provided with various electrical components for driving the compressor, one of which is a reactor. The reactor is used to reduce noise generated when the compressor is driven by the inverter, but is relatively large and heavy because of the structure in which the copper wire coil is wound around the laminated iron core.

そのため、多くの場合、リアクタは、電装品ユニットに金属製の専用ブラケットを介して固定される(例えば、特許文献1参照)。   Therefore, in many cases, the reactor is fixed to the electrical component unit through a metal dedicated bracket (see, for example, Patent Document 1).

ところで、図4に示すように、リアクタ1とともに大電流遮断用のリレー2を付設する場合、電装品ユニットのスペースは限られているため、リアクタ固定用のブラケット3にリレー固定台4を連設して、そこにリレー2をネジ止めするようにしている。   By the way, as shown in FIG. 4, when the relay 2 for interrupting a large current is provided together with the reactor 1, the space for the electrical component unit is limited, so the relay fixing base 4 is connected to the bracket 3 for fixing the reactor. Then, the relay 2 is screwed there.

しかしながら、リレー2をブラケット3のリレー固定台4にネジ止めする場合、リレー2をリレー固定台4に押し当てて押さえながらネジ止めする必要があるため、作業性がよくない。   However, when the relay 2 is screwed to the relay fixing base 4 of the bracket 3, the workability is not good because it is necessary to press the relay 2 against the relay fixing base 4 and press and hold it.

そこで、本発明の課題は、リレーの電装品ユニットへの取り付けを容易に行うことができるようにすることにある。   Then, the subject of this invention is enabling it to attach to the electrical component unit of a relay easily.

上記課題を解決するため、本発明は、圧縮機駆動用の電気部品を有する電装品ユニットを含む室外機を備え、上記電装品ユニットにリアクタ固定台を有するブラケットが取り付けられている空気調和機において、
上記ブラケットには、上記リアクタ固定台に隣接してリレーを固定するリレー固定台が設けられており、上記リレー固定台には、上記リレーを固定する位置に保持する仮止め手段が設けられていることを特徴としている。
In order to solve the above problems, the present invention provides an air conditioner including an outdoor unit including an electrical component unit having electrical components for driving a compressor, and a bracket having a reactor fixing base attached to the electrical component unit. ,
The bracket is provided with a relay fixing base for fixing a relay adjacent to the reactor fixing base, and the relay fixing base is provided with a temporary fixing means for holding the relay in a position for fixing. It is characterized by that.

本発明の好ましい態様によると、上記仮止め手段は、少なくとも上記リレーの上下2箇所を保持する係止爪を備えている。   According to a preferred aspect of the present invention, the temporary fixing means includes a locking claw for holding at least two upper and lower positions of the relay.

また、上記係止爪は、上記リレー固定台から切り起こされた爪であることが好ましい。   Moreover, it is preferable that the said latching claw is a nail | claw cut and raised from the said relay fixing stand.

本発明によれば、リレー固定台のリレーを固定する位置にリレーを保持する仮止め手段(好ましくはリレー固定台から切り起こされた係止爪)を設けたことにより、リレー固定台にリレーを固定するにあたって、リレーを押さえておく必要がなく、リレーの固定作業を容易に行うことができる。   According to the present invention, the provision of the temporary fixing means (preferably the locking claw cut and raised from the relay fixing base) for holding the relay at the position for fixing the relay of the relay fixing base allows the relay to be fixed to the relay fixing base. In fixing, it is not necessary to hold the relay, and the fixing work of the relay can be easily performed.

次に、図1ないし図3により、本発明の実施形態について説明するが、本発明はこれに限定されるものではない。   Next, an embodiment of the present invention will be described with reference to FIGS. 1 to 3, but the present invention is not limited to this.

図1ないし図3を参照して、本発明では、図1に示すブラケット10を用いてリアクタ1とリレー2を電装品ユニット5に設置する。なお、図2には電装品ユニット5の一部のみが示されている。   With reference to FIG. 1 thru | or FIG. 3, in this invention, the reactor 1 and the relay 2 are installed in the electrical component unit 5 using the bracket 10 shown in FIG. FIG. 2 shows only a part of the electrical component unit 5.

ブラケット10は好ましくは金属製であり、この実施形態では、図2に示すように、ブラケット10は、電装品ユニット5の一部を構成する例えば室外機内を熱交換室と機械室とに仕切る仕切板5aに取り付けられるが、これ以外の例えば上記機械室内の所定の支持部材(支持板)に取り付けられてもよい。   The bracket 10 is preferably made of metal. In this embodiment, as shown in FIG. 2, the bracket 10 is a partition that forms a part of the electrical component unit 5, for example, an interior of an outdoor unit divided into a heat exchange chamber and a machine room. Although it is attached to the plate 5a, it may be attached to a predetermined support member (support plate) other than this, for example, in the machine room.

ブラケット10には、リアクタ1を固定するリアクタ固定台11と、リレー2を固定するリレー固定台13とが含まれている。リアクタ固定台11とリレー固定台13は、1枚の金属板のプレス加工により一体に形成することができる。   The bracket 10 includes a reactor fixing base 11 that fixes the reactor 1 and a relay fixing base 13 that fixes the relay 2. The reactor fixing base 11 and the relay fixing base 13 can be integrally formed by pressing one metal plate.

この実施形態において、ブラケット10の上部にリアクタ固定台11が配置され、ブラケット10の下部にリレー固定台13が配置されているが、リアクタ固定台11の上辺、リレー固定台13の下辺およびリアクタ固定台11とリレー固定台13の間には、それぞれ、仕切板5a側に向けて折り曲げられた支持脚101,102,103が形成されており、これら支持脚101,102,103により、リアクタ固定台11およびリレー固定台13は、ともに仕切板5aとの間で所定間隔の空隙が生ずるように仕切板5aに取り付けられる。   In this embodiment, the reactor fixing base 11 is arranged at the upper part of the bracket 10 and the relay fixing base 13 is arranged at the lower part of the bracket 10. However, the upper side of the reactor fixing base 11, the lower side of the relay fixing base 13, and the reactor fixing Support legs 101, 102, and 103 are formed between the base 11 and the relay fixing base 13 so as to be bent toward the partition plate 5 a side. The support legs 101, 102, and 103 form the reactor fixing base. 11 and the relay fixing base 13 are both attached to the partition plate 5a so that a gap of a predetermined interval is generated between the partition plate 5a and the relay support base 13.

リアクタ固定台11の下方には、リアクタ1が有する四角形状の支持基板1aの下辺両端が上方から嵌合される受け溝部111(111a,111b)が左右2箇所に設けられている。   Below the reactor fixing base 11, receiving groove portions 111 (111 a and 111 b) in which the lower ends of the rectangular support substrate 1 a of the reactor 1 are fitted from above are provided at two positions on the left and right.

この例において、左側の受け溝部111aと右側の受け溝部111bはともにプレス加工により四角台形状に形成されるが、左側の受け溝部111aは、上辺および右側辺がリアクタ固定台11から切り離されるように形成され、右側の受け溝部111bは、上辺および左側辺がリアクタ固定台11から切り離されるように形成される。   In this example, the left receiving groove 111a and the right receiving groove 111b are both formed into a square trapezoidal shape by pressing, but the left receiving groove 111a is separated from the reactor fixing base 11 at the upper side and the right side. The right receiving groove 111b is formed such that the upper side and the left side are separated from the reactor fixing base 11.

リレー固定台13には、リレー2を固定する位置に保持する仮止め手段131が設けられている。この実施形態において、仮止め手段131は、リレー固定台13から切り起こされた係止爪131aからなる。   The relay fixing base 13 is provided with temporary fixing means 131 for holding the relay 2 at a position for fixing. In this embodiment, the temporary fixing means 131 includes a locking claw 131 a cut and raised from the relay fixing base 13.

この実施形態において、係止爪131aは、リレー2をリレー2の筐体2aの上面中央部の1箇所と、筐体2aの下面の左右2箇所の合計3箇所で挟んで保持できる位置に配置されているが、少なくとも筐体2aの上下2箇所で挟んで保持できる位置に配置されていればよい。   In this embodiment, the locking claw 131a is arranged at a position where the relay 2 can be held between a total of three locations, one at the center of the upper surface of the housing 2a of the relay 2 and two at the left and right of the lower surface of the housing 2a. However, it should just be arrange | positioned in the position which can be pinched | interposed and hold | maintained at the upper and lower two places of the housing | casing 2a.

また、リレー2の筐体2aの左右両側辺には耳板2bが一体に形成されており、その各々には、ほぼU字状をなすネジ挿通溝2cが形成されている。これ対応して、リレー固定台13の左右2箇所には、リレー2をネジ止めするための雌ネジ孔132が設けられている。   Further, ear plates 2b are integrally formed on the left and right sides of the housing 2a of the relay 2, and screw insertion grooves 2c each having a substantially U shape are formed in each of the ear plates 2b. Correspondingly, female screw holes 132 for screwing the relay 2 are provided at two positions on the left and right sides of the relay fixing base 13.

このブラケット10によれば、リアクタ1をリアクタ固定部11にネジ止めすることができるとともに、リレー2をリレー固定部13にネジ止めすることができるが、特にリレー2をリレー固定部13にネジ止めする際、リレー2が係止爪131aにより固定する位置に保持され、リレー2から両手を離してもリレー2が落下することがないため、リレー2を押さえながらネジ止めする必要がなくなり、リレーのネジ止め作業を容易に行うことができる。   According to this bracket 10, the reactor 1 can be screwed to the reactor fixing portion 11 and the relay 2 can be screwed to the relay fixing portion 13. In particular, the relay 2 is screwed to the relay fixing portion 13. The relay 2 is held at a position where the relay 2 is fixed by the locking claw 131a, and the relay 2 does not fall even if both hands are released from the relay 2. Therefore, it is not necessary to screw the relay 2 while holding the relay 2. Screwing work can be easily performed.

また、リアクタ固定部11およびリレー固定部13は、その背面側が仕切り板5aから離されているため放熱性にも優れている。   Moreover, since the reactor fixing | fixed part 11 and the relay fixing | fixed part 13 are separated from the partition plate 5a in the back side, they are excellent also in heat dissipation.
